MSDN Magazine Giugno 2014
TypeScript:
Ottimizzare l'investimento per JavaScript grazie a TypeScript
L'investimento effettuato per JavaScript non deve essere sprecato. La migrazione a TypeScript permette di avvalersi dell'impegno dedicato al codice JavaScript e incoraggia l'adozione di nuove funzionalità che supportano una maggiore produttività in applicazioni su larga scala. Bill Wagner
ASP.NET MVC:
Override dei modelli di scaffolding predefiniti
Poiché la codifica ripetuta di operazioni CRUD (Create, Retrieve, Update and Delete) può risultare noiosa, è possibile automatizzare il processo grazie ai modelli di scaffolding. In genere, l'automatizzazione impedisce aggiornamenti o modifiche a controller o visualizzazioni, ma è possibile personalizzare tali elementi. Jonathan Waldman
ASP.NET:
Topshelf e Katana: architettura unificata per Web e servizi
Grazie al progetto Katana, alla libreria open source Topshelf e alle specifiche OWIN, è ora possibile creare un'architettuta unificata per Web e servizi con un processo di distribuzione semplicissimo. Wes McClure
MVVM:
Informazioni dettagliate su MVVM Light Messenger
Laurent Bugnion completa la sua serie sullo sviluppo MVVM (Model-View-View Model) con un esame approfondito di MVVM Light Messenger, in cui vengono esaminati i vantaggi derivanti dalla semplicità d'uso e i potenziali rischi associati. Laurent Bugnion
SharePoint:
Uso di JSLink con SharePoint 2013
Grazie a JSLink, una nuova funzionalità di SharePoint 2013, è possibile visualizzare campi personalizzati nel client in modo molto più semplice e reattivo, come illustrato da Pritam Baldota. Pritam Baldota
Rubriche
|
Nota del redattore:
Vulnerabilità Heartbleed
La vulnerabilità Heart Bleed in OpenSSL ha reso evidente il fatto che la qualità del software dipende dalle persone che lo scrivono e lo verificano.
Michael Desmond
|
Cutting Edge:
Autenticazione esterna con ASP.NET Identity
Dino Esposito mostra come eseguire l'autenticazione tramite un server esterno basato su OAuth o OpenID, ad esempio un social network, e illustra le procedure da eseguire dopo il completamento dell'autenticazione.
Dino Esposito
|
Windows con C++:
Disposizione di finestre su più livelli con prestazioni elevate mediante il motore della composizione Windows
Kenny Kerr mostra come usare capacità di sistema in precedenza inaccessibili alle applicazioni per creare l'effetto di finestre su più livelli senza compromettere le prestazioni.
Kenny Kerr
|
|
Azure Insider:
Inserimento e analisi di dati di telemetria con i servizi di Microsoft Azure
La raccolta di quantità elevate di dati di telemetria è inutile senza un'analisi e un'elaborazione significativa dei dati. Per semplificare il processo, è possibile usare Microsoft Azure.
Bruno Terkaly, Ricardo Villalobos, Thomas Conte
|
Esecuzione di test:
Uso del set di dati MNIST per il riconoscimento di immagini
James McCaffrey presenta il set di dati MNIST e il riconoscimento di immagini, uno degli argomenti più affascinanti nel campo del Machine Learning.
James McCaffrey
|
DirectX Factor:
Area di disegno e fotocamera
Quando si passa dalla programmazione 2D alla programmazione 3D, l'area di disegno metaforica deve essere supplementata con una fotocamera metaforica. Charles Petzold spiega come.
Charles Petzold
|
|
Una provocazione:
VB6 e l'arte del lancio a effetto
L'ultimo articolo di David Platt su VB6 rimane uno degli articoli recenti più letti e commentati di MSDN Magazine. Platt spiega perché.
David Platt
|
Receive the MSDN Flash e-mail newsletter every other week, with news and information personalized to your interests and areas of focus.
Subscribe to MSDN Flash newsletter